The Belfer Center for Science and International Affairs will host a
directors' lunch with General-Lieutenant Evgeniy Buzhinskiy, Former Head
of International Treaties Directorate, Russian Ministry of Defense, and
Acting Head of the International Military Cooperation Directorate.
General Buzhinskiy's last position on active duty was the Russian
Ministry of Defense's Head of International Treaties Directorate and
Acting Head of the International Military Cooperation Directorate. He
has been intimately involved in developing and deploying Russian
international policies in the political military sphere. General
Buzhinskiy will explore the various aspects of Russian security policy
especially in the area of nuclear issues and illuminate the connections
and consistencies in those policies. He will discuss his thoughts on
Nuclear Arms, Strategic Balance, Missile Defense, Iran, Terrorism,
Russia's Military Doctrine and other US-Russian policy issues.
